• 西门子6ES7515-5FN03-0AB0型号规格
  • 西门子6ES7515-5FN03-0AB0型号规格
  • 西门子6ES7515-5FN03-0AB0型号规格

产品描述

产品规格模块式包装说明全新品牌西门值+ 包装说明 全新 - 产品规格子 现场安装

西门子6ES7515-5FN03-0AB0型号规格


4 监控系统的通讯网络
        在工业控制领域,尤其是大型企业(如港口码头)的控制系统将是一个功能多样而完善的通讯网络,不但具有控制信号的采集、传输、控制输出,还要具有故障报警、信息查询、打印输出、视频等功能。这样一个控制网络还必须具有与企业管理网络甚至互联网络相连的接口,以备将来实现整个企业内部的信息交互或远程诊断功能。基于这些要求,该工业过程控制系统采用双环容错光纤网络构成企业局域网的**干网,网络能要求传输速率达到10Mbps。
        中控室PLC主站是系统控制站的信息处理中心。它的主要功能是将其它远程PLC从站采集到的数据进行处理与存储,并通过网络送到各操作员站或工程师站的显示屏上进行显示;同时,接受操作员站或工程师站的操作指令进行处理后发送到PLC从站。
         PLC主站主要由2套互为热备份的S7-400H型PLC控制器组成,这是SIMATIC系列产品中性能较高、可靠性较好的一种PLC控制器。每个PLC控制器均设有1个PS407电源模块、一个CPU-416H*处理器模块和一个CP443-1工业以太网通讯模块,它们安装在一个特殊紧凑的UR2-H机架上。这两个CPU模块上各插有Syne()模块,并通过光缆相互连接,实现了2个PLC控制器的相互数据通讯。在系统运行过程中,2个PLC 控制器能自动更新数据,确保数据的一致性。当某个PLC控制器出现故障时,另一个PLC控制器能自动在中断处接管后续所有信息处理工作,不会丢失任何数据,保证了系统正常运行及与上位中控室计算机的通讯。
中控室S7-400H型主站的2个CPU模块上各有1个PROFIBUS-DP通讯接口,它们通过光纤网络与远程PLC从站相连接;远程PLC 选用S7-200,通过现场总线与现场分布式I/O进行单工通讯,对现场设备进行信号的处理与控制。分布式I/O采用SIEMENS的ET200S。ET200S系统具有较好的诊断功能。不仅模块上的状态和故障指示灯可提供当前运行状态信息,而且模块中的每个通道都能自动生成清晰的文本信息,这些信息,如传感器连线的短路或开路等故障信息,可通过PROFIBUS网络送到系统主站,在系统操作员或工程师站的显示屏上进行告警提示,以便及时处理。
         每个PLC主站通过CP443-1工业以太网通讯模块连接的双重容错高速工业以太网与操作员计算机和工程师计算机相连。这样冗余连接的网络拓扑结构,当系统某一网络通道发生故障时,能自动另一网络通道,以确保系统通讯的可靠性。PLC主站具有自诊断功能,系统在错误对过程产生影响前就可探测错误并发出警报。通过扩展的PROFIBUS-DP诊断功能可以对故障进行快速,诊断信息在总线上传输并由主站采集。
本地PLC主站与远程PLC从站之间以及各远程PLC从站之间的室外通讯电缆采用多模光纤电缆,这样不仅可预防雷击,而且具有可靠的抗静电、抗磁场干扰能力。选用先进的OLM/S4光链路转换器,各PLC控制器间形成环形的光纤网络,实现了室外通讯网络的容错设计,光纤中的任意一根出现故障时,网络通讯均不会中断,并能及时进行故障告警,进一步提高了系统网络通讯的可靠性。

5、结束语
        本方案技术先进,结构简单。S7-400与分布式I/O ET200S功能强、体积小,因此控制柜内部结构简单,便于与维修。使用了PROFIBUS-DP现场总线,减少了电缆的铺设量,实现了数字通信,提高了数据传送精度。所有部件在运行过程中都能热插拔,在更换CPU模块时,系统将自动更新为当前程序和数据,因此系统具有很好的联机维修功能。
         该控制网络系统以独立的、单体的、分散的测量与控制设备为网络节点,以现场总线为纽带,并把它们连接成为可以互相沟通信息,共同完成自动化控制任务的控制与网络系统。具备高度的实时性、安全性和可靠性,系统容错性能好。易于实现与信息网络的互联和集成,从而为管理信息网络系统和自动化控制网络系统的一体化集成奠定了基础

202202231632210850864.jpg202202231632207636284.jpg


3 通讯协议

本通信协议应用于D08-8CZM型流量积算仪与上位机的通信,数据以16进制格式传输,波特率:9600;数据位8位;停止位:1位;效验位:无。本协议与MODBUS协议兼容,可以通过上位机显示流量积算仪的瞬时流量、累积流量、满量程、单位和阀状态(包括阀控、关闭和清洗),而且可以通过上位机设定流量积算仪的瞬时流量、使流量积算仪的累积流量清零。因此在本协议用到了MODBUS协议的命令$03(Reading 1~9words)、命令$05(Force single coil)和命令$06(Writing 1 word)。

使用命令$03可以通过上位机读流量积算仪的当前状态,其通信协议的具体格式为:

上位机 积算仪:01 03 00 02 00 08 E5 CC

各字节含义:

01: MODBUS地址;
03: 功能码03(Reading 1~9words);
00 02:起始地址,00为高8位,02为低8位;
00 08:读取的字数;
E5 CC:CRC效验值,E5为CRC的低8位,CC为高8位。

上位机 积算仪:01 03 10 (1)~(16) CRCL CRCH

各字节含义:

01:MODBUS地址;
03:MODBUS命令号;
10:上传的字节数;

(1)~(4):瞬时流量值;“00~09”表示数字“0~9”,“10~19”表示“0.~9.”;
(5)~(10):流量累积值;同上;
(11)~(14):满量程;同上;
(15):流量单位;00表示SCCM和SCC,01表示SCCM和SL,11表示SLM和SL;
(16):阀状态;00表示关闭,80表示阀控,FF表示清洗;
CRCL:CRC的低八位;CRCH:CRC的高8位。

3、用VB实现串行通讯

3.1 MSComm控件

VB的通信控件MSComm能够提供串行通信的全部功能,程序编写、调试简单方便,开发速度快,该控件封装了通信过程中的底层操作程序,用户只需设置和监控控件的属性和事件,就可以方便地实现异步串行通信。

采用MSComm控件接收数据,按照接收方式分两种形式:事件驱动方式,定时查询方式。本例为适应流量的实时控制采用定时驱动方式,若定时器计时到,通过串行通信口向*流量积算仪发出读写等操作命令,等待时间到则检查InBufferCount属性值来判断输入缓冲区中是否接受到了相应数目的字符,从而进行读取、判断数据合法性和数据存储、处理等操作。




http://zhangqueena.b2b168.com

产品推荐